Man arrested for dagga cultivation

After a tip-off from the community, Benoni police's Col Mark Naidoo and his crime prevention team arrested a man on a charge of cultivating dagga in Farrarmere Gardens this morning (October 11).

A total of 105 pot plants of dagga were found in the house.

A bag of dagga was also found in the suspect car.
Benoni SAPS spokesperson Const Zama Madonda said it is alleged that the man sells dagga to school children.
The 35-year-old man will be charged for cultivation of dagga.
He is expected to appear in the Benoni Magistrate’s Court soon.
